Web1 Using the Lewis Bag While you can use a blender in a pinch, the secret to really great crushed ice is a tool called a Lewis bag. Essentially, a Lewis bag is just a canvas pouch. … WebIn order to make crushed ice like Sonic, you’ll need a few key items. First, you’ll need a powerful blender or food processor. Most blenders and food processors have an ice crush setting, which will help you make smaller pieces of ice. You can also use a hand-held ice crusher if you don’t have a blender or food processor.
